Freigeben über


REVOKE-Sucheigenschaftenlisten-Berechtigungen (Transact-SQL)

Gilt für: SQL Server Azure SQL Managed Instance

Hebt Berechtigungen für eine Sucheigenschaftenliste auf.

Transact-SQL-Syntaxkonventionen

Syntax

  
REVOKE [ GRANT OPTION FOR ] permission [ ,...n ] ON  
        SEARCH PROPERTY LIST :: search_property_list_name  
    { TO | FROM } database_principal [ ,...n ]  
    [ CASCADE ]  
    [ AS revoking_principal ]  

Argumente

GRANT OPTION FOR
Gibt an, dass das Recht zum Erteilen der angegebenen Berechtigung für andere Prinzipale aufgehoben wird. Die Berechtigung selbst wird nicht aufgehoben.

Wichtig

Falls der Prinzipal die angegebene Berechtigung ohne GRANT-Option besitzt, wird die Berechtigung selbst aufgehoben.

permission
Der Name einer Berechtigung. Die gültigen Zuordnungen von Berechtigungen zu sicherungsfähigen Elementen werden im Abschnitt mit den Hinweisen weiter unten in diesem Thema beschrieben.

ON SEARCH PROPERTY LIST ::search_property_list_name
Gibt die Sucheigenschaftenliste an, für die die Berechtigung aufgehoben wird. Der Bereichsqualifizierer :: ist erforderlich.

database_principal
Gibt den Prinzipal an, für den die Berechtigung aufgehoben wird. Die folgenden Prinzipale sind möglich:

  • Datenbankbenutzer

  • Datenbankrolle (database role)

  • Anwendungsrolle

  • Einem Windows-Anmeldenamen zugeordneter Datenbankbenutzer

  • Einer Windows-Gruppe zugeordneter Datenbankbenutzer

  • Einem Zertifikat zugeordneter Datenbankbenutzer

  • Einem asymmetrischen Schlüssel zugeordneter Datenbankbenutzer

  • Keinem Serverprinzipal zugeordneter Datenbankbenutzer.

CASCADE
Gibt an, dass die aufgehobene Berechtigung auch für andere Prinzipale aufgehoben wird, denen diese Berechtigung vom Prinzipal erteilt wurde.

Achtung

Durch ein kaskadiertes Aufheben einer Berechtigung, die mit WITH GRANT OPTION erteilt wurde, werden sowohl GRANT als auch DENY für diese Berechtigung aufgehoben.

AS revoking_principal
Gibt einen Prinzipal an, von dem der Prinzipal, der diese Abfrage ausführt, sein Recht zum Aufheben der Berechtigung ableitet. Die folgenden Prinzipale sind möglich:

  • Datenbankbenutzer

  • Datenbankrolle (database role)

  • Anwendungsrolle

  • Einem Windows-Anmeldenamen zugeordneter Datenbankbenutzer

  • Einer Windows-Gruppe zugeordneter Datenbankbenutzer

  • Einem Zertifikat zugeordneter Datenbankbenutzer

  • Einem asymmetrischen Schlüssel zugeordneter Datenbankbenutzer

  • Keinem Serverprinzipal zugeordneter Datenbankbenutzer.

Bemerkungen

SEARCH PROPERTY LIST-Berechtigungen

Eine Sucheigenschaftenliste ist ein sicherungsfähiges Element auf Datenbankebene in der Datenbank, die das übergeordnete Element in der Berechtigungshierarchie ist. Die spezifischsten und restriktivsten Berechtigungen, die für eine Sucheigenschaftenliste aufgehoben werden können, sind unten aufgeführt. Auch die allgemeineren Berechtigungen sind aufgeführt, die diese implizit enthalten.

Sucheigenschaftenlisten-Berechtigung Impliziert durch Sucheigenschaftenlisten-Berechtigung Impliziert durch Datenbankberechtigung
ALTER CONTROL ALTER ANY FULLTEXT CATALOG
CONTROL CONTROL CONTROL
REFERENCES CONTROL REFERENCES
TAKE OWNERSHIP CONTROL CONTROL
VIEW DEFINITION CONTROL VIEW DEFINITION

Berechtigungen

Erfordert die CONTROL-Berechtigung für den Volltextkatalog.

Siehe auch

CREATE APPLICATION ROLE (Transact-SQL)
CREATE ASYMMETRIC KEY (Transact-SQL)
CREATE CERTIFICATE (Transact-SQL)
CREATE SEARCH PROPERTY LIST (Transact-SQL)
DENY-Sucheigenschaftenlisten-Berechtigung (Transact-SQL)
Verschlüsselungshierarchie
sys.fn_my_permissions (Transact-SQL)
GRANT-Sucheigenschaftenlisten-Berechtigungen (Transact-SQL)
HAS_PERMS_BY_NAME (Transact-SQL)
Prinzipale (Datenbank-Engine)
REVOKE (Transact-SQL)
sys.fn_builtin_permissions (Transact-SQL)
sys.registered_search_property_lists (Transact-SQL)
Suchen von Dokumenteigenschaften mithilfe von Sucheigenschaftenlisten
Suchen von Dokumenteigenschaften mithilfe von Sucheigenschaftenlisten